Which hold more heat for longer period of time ?

A. Air
B. Water


Sagot :

Answer:

water

Explanation:

The heat capacity of a material, along with its total mass and its temperature, tell us how much thermal energy is stored in a material. ... The result is that the temperature of the water cube is much more stable than the air — the water changes much more slowly; it holds onto its temperature longer.

Answer:

B. water

Explanation:

Water's high heat capacity is a property caused by hydrogen bonding among water molecules. When heat is absorbed, hydrogen bonds are broken and water molecules can move freely. As a result, it takes water a long time to heat and a long time to cool.
